What is the Mississippi Lien
The Mississippi lien is a legal claim against a property or asset that ensures the payment of a debt or obligation. It serves as a public notice to potential buyers or creditors that a particular property is encumbered. This type of lien can arise from various situations, such as unpaid taxes, loans, or judgments. Understanding the nature of a Mississippi lien is crucial for property owners and creditors alike, as it affects ownership rights and the ability to sell or refinance the property.
How to use the Mississippi Lien
Utilizing the Mississippi lien involves several steps, primarily focusing on compliance with state laws and proper documentation. Creditors must file the lien with the appropriate county clerk's office where the property is located. This filing creates a public record, making the lien enforceable. Once filed, the lien can be used to secure payment for debts owed, and it may also influence the creditworthiness of the property owner. Proper use of the lien can protect creditors' interests and ensure that debts are settled appropriately.
Steps to complete the Mississippi Lien
Completing a Mississippi lien requires careful attention to detail. Here are the essential steps:
- Gather necessary information about the debtor and the property.
- Prepare the lien document, ensuring all required information is included.
- File the lien with the county clerk's office in the county where the property is located.
- Pay any applicable filing fees associated with the lien submission.
- Obtain a copy of the filed lien for your records.
Following these steps ensures that the lien is valid and enforceable under Mississippi law.
Legal use of the Mississippi Lien
The legal use of a Mississippi lien is governed by state laws, which outline the rights and responsibilities of both creditors and debtors. Creditors must ensure that the lien is filed correctly and within the statutory time limits to maintain its validity. Additionally, debtors have the right to contest the lien if they believe it was filed improperly or if the debt is disputed. Understanding these legal frameworks helps both parties navigate their rights and obligations effectively.
Key elements of the Mississippi Lien
Several key elements define a Mississippi lien, including:
- The name of the debtor and creditor.
- A description of the property subject to the lien.
- The amount of the debt owed.
- The date the lien was filed.
- Any relevant legal citations or references.
These elements are essential for the lien to be enforceable and to provide clear information to all parties involved.
